> Great! What about:
> 
>   
> <dc:format>osgeo:http://geonetwork3.fao.org/ows/1[application/vnd.ogc.wms]</dc:format>

Can you just copy what Atom does?

<link type="application/vnd.ogc.wms" 
href="http://geonetwork3.fao.org/ows/1"/>

That seems like a much neater solution than having to invent arbitrary 
rules for parsing the content of <dc:format>.

> 'osgeo' is a hierarchical scheme name as required by the URI RFC 2396. 
> Let's call it an osgeoURL. It consists of an underlying URL-reference 
> followed by the mime type in brackets. An osgeoURL can be defined with 
> the following ABNF:
> 
>     osgeoURL = "osgeo:" URI-reference "[" mime-type "]"

Its almost always a bad idea to invent new URI schemes.

http://www.w3.org/TR/webarch/#URI-scheme
